Introducing David Blankenborg…

David is a compassionate and experienced HCA based in Victoria, BC, with over five years of hands-on experience caring for seniors. His focus is on improving the health, happiness, and overall quality of life for elderly individuals, particularly in the areas of companionship and daily support. David started his career as a porter with VIHA, where he discovered his passion for patient care and decided to pursue further training in nursing. However, he ultimately found his true calling in providing personalized, client-centered care for seniors.

With his strong medical background and a warm, empathetic approach, David is not only a skilled caregiver but also an effective advocate, ensuring that families feel supported and informed throughout their loved one’s care journey. David specializes in dementia care and works closely with families and healthcare teams to create a comfortable and supportive environment. His services are available throughout the Greater Victoria area, offering peace of mind to families seeking high-quality care for their loved ones, both at home and in long-term care facilities.
